Technical Problem

During the manufacturing process of solar cells, the placement of the heat insulation box, thermocouple probe, and solar cell is not fixed while the mesh belt or ceramic roller is running. This makes it impossible to guarantee the consistency and accuracy of repeated measurements, and the thermocouple is easily detached from the solar cell due to vibration, resulting in measurement failure.

Method used

A solar cell temperature measuring device including a first carrier plate and a second carrier plate is adopted. The solar cells and heat insulation boxes are fixed to their respective carrier plates by the first fixing component and the second fixing component to ensure accurate positioning and prevent relative movement during the operation of the mesh belt or ceramic roller. The thermocouple is fixed to the first carrier plate by the limiting ring to prevent detachment.

Benefits of technology

This improves the consistency of repeated tests and the accuracy of temperature measurements, prevents the thermocouple from detaching from the battery during vibration, and ensures the stability and accuracy of temperature measurements.

[0002] In the manufacturing process of solar cells, after screen printing, the cells need to be sintered at high temperatures, and the sintering temperature is one of the important factors affecting the cell conversion efficiency. By monitoring the changes in the sintering furnace temperature, fluctuations in temperature can be avoided that cause a decrease in the conversion efficiency of the solar cells.

[0003] The current common method for measuring the temperature profile of a sintering furnace involves placing the measuring instrument directly in an insulation box, which is then placed on the mesh belt or ceramic roller of the sintering furnace. The thermocouple probe is then extended from the insulation box to the surface of the solar cell placed directly on the mesh belt or ceramic roller. However, during the process of the mesh belt or ceramic roller carrying the insulation box, thermocouple probe, and solar cell into the sintering furnace, the mesh belt or ceramic roller is constantly in motion. This results in the placement of the insulation box, thermocouple probe, and solar cell being unreliable, causing the contact point between the thermocouple and the solar cell to be out of place. Consequently, the consistency of repeated measurements and the accuracy of temperature measurements cannot be guaranteed.

[0039] like Figures 1-6 As shown, this embodiment provides a solar cell temperature measuring device, which includes a first carrier plate 11, a first fixing component, a second carrier plate 21, and a second fixing component. The first carrier plate 11 carries the solar cell 300, and the first fixing component fixes the solar cell 300 onto the first carrier plate 11. The first carrier plate 11 and the first fixing component are high-temperature resistant components. The second carrier plate 21 carries the heat insulation box 400, and the second fixing component fixes the heat insulation box 400 onto the second carrier plate 21. The second carrier plate 21 and the second fixing component are high-temperature resistant components, and the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 are fixedly connected. When the solar cell temperature measuring device is set on the mesh belt 100 or the ceramic roller 200, the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 are fixedly connected. Therefore, the mesh belt 100 or the ceramic roller 200 carries the solar cell, the heat insulation box 400, and the thermocouple 500 on the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 into the sintering furnace. Since the heat insulation box 400 and the battery cell 300 are both pre-set on the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21, their relative positions can be precisely controlled, thereby improving the consistency and accuracy of repeated tests. Furthermore, since the first fixing component fixes the battery cell 300 to the first carrier plate 11 and the second fixing component fixes the heat insulation box 400 to the second carrier plate 21, the vibrations of the conveyor belt 100 or the ceramic roller 200 during operation will not cause the battery cell 300 to move relative to the first carrier plate 11 or the heat insulation box 400 to move relative to the second carrier plate 21, thus preventing the thermocouple 500 from detaching from the battery cell 300.

[0040] Optionally, the width of the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 is a, and the width of the mesh belt or ceramic roller of the sintering furnace is b, where -2cm ≤ ab ≤ 2cm. Specifically, the length of the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 is 45cm-50cm, and the thickness is 2cm-3cm.

[0041] Optionally, the first fixing component includes at least two first fixing members 12, which are spaced apart circumferentially around the battery cell 300 and used to fix the circumferential edge of the battery cell 300. In this embodiment, this arrangement can improve the stability of fixing the battery cell 300. Specifically, the battery cell 300 is rectangular or square; therefore, four first fixing members 12 are provided, and the four first fixing members 12 respectively fix the four corners of the battery cell 300.

[0042] Optionally, the first carrier plate 11 is provided with at least two first guide blind holes 111 corresponding one-to-one with the first fixing member 12; the first fixing member 12 includes a first pressure plate 121, a first guide post 122 and a first elastic member 123. One end of the first guide post 122 is inserted into the corresponding first guide blind hole 111, and the other end of the first guide post 122 is fixedly connected to the first pressure plate 121. The first pressure plate 121 is located on the side of the battery cell 300 away from the first carrier plate 11 and abuts against the battery cell 300. The first elastic member 123 is disposed in the first guide blind hole 111. One end of the first elastic member 123 is fixedly connected to the bottom wall of the first guide blind hole 111, and the other end of the first elastic member 123 is fixedly connected to the first guide post 122. The first elastic member 123 makes the first guide post 122 always have a tendency to extend into the first guide blind hole 111. In this embodiment, the first guide post 122 slides within the first guide blind hole 111, thereby adjusting the distance between the first pressure plate 121 and the first carrier plate 11. Since the first elastic member 123 makes the first guide post 122 always have a tendency to extend into the first guide blind hole 111, the first elastic member 123 presses the first pressure plate 121 onto the battery cell 300, thereby fixing the battery cell 300 relative to the first carrier plate 11.

[0043] Optionally, before placing the battery cell 300 on the first carrier plate 11, at least two of the first guide posts 122 of the first fixing members 12 need to be rotated so that the first pressure plate 121 is not opposite to the battery cell placement area on the first carrier plate 11 along the axial direction of the first guide post 122. This ensures that when the battery cell 300 is placed in the battery cell placement area, the first pressure plate 121 will not interfere with the battery cell 300. After the battery cell 300 is placed in the battery cell placement area, the first guide post 122 is rotated again so that the first pressure plate 121 is opposite to the battery cell 300 in the battery cell placement area along the axial direction of the first guide post 122. The first elastic member 123 can then make the first pressure plate 121 press the battery cell 300 tightly.

[0044] Optionally, the second fixing component includes at least two second fixing members 22, which are spaced apart circumferentially around the insulation box 400 and used to fix the circumferential edge of the insulation box 400. In this embodiment, this arrangement can improve the stability of fixing the insulation box 400. Specifically, the insulation box 400 is rectangular; therefore, four first fixing members 12 are provided, and the four first fixing members 12 respectively fix the four corners of the insulation box 400.

[0045] Optionally, the second carrier plate 21 is provided with at least two second guide blind holes 211 corresponding one-to-one with the second fixing member 22; the second fixing member 22 includes a second pressure plate 221, a second guide post 222 and a second elastic member 223. One end of the second guide post 222 is inserted into the corresponding second guide blind hole 211, and the other end of the second guide post 222 is fixedly connected to the second pressure plate 221. The second pressure plate 221 is located on the side of the heat insulation box 400 away from the second carrier plate 21 and abuts against the heat insulation box 400. The second elastic member 223 is disposed in the second guide blind hole 211. One end of the second elastic member 223 is fixedly connected to the bottom wall of the second guide blind hole 211, and the other end of the second elastic member 223 is fixedly connected to the second guide post 222. The second elastic member 223 makes the second guide post 222 always have a tendency to extend into the second guide blind hole 211. In this embodiment, the second guide post 222 slides within the second guide blind hole 211, thereby adjusting the distance between the second pressure plate 221 and the second carrier plate 21. Furthermore, since the second elastic member 223 ensures that the second guide post 222 always has a tendency to extend into the second guide blind hole 211, the second elastic member 223 presses the second pressure plate 221 onto the heat insulation box 400, thereby fixing the heat insulation box 400 relative to the second carrier plate 21.

[0046] Optionally, before the insulation box 400 is placed on the second carrier plate 21, the second guide posts 222 of at least two second fixing members 22 need to be rotated so that the second pressure plate 221 is not opposite to the insulation box placement area on the second carrier plate 21 along the axial direction of the second guide posts 222. This prevents the second pressure plate 221 from interfering with the insulation box 400 when it is placed in the insulation box placement area. Then, the second guide posts 222 are rotated again so that the second pressure plate 221 is opposite to the insulation box 400 in the insulation box placement area along the axial direction of the second guide posts 222. The second elastic member 223 can then press the insulation box 400 tightly with the second pressure plate 221.

[0047] Optionally, the first carrier plate 11 is provided with a first recess 113 for accommodating the battery cell 300; the second carrier plate 21 is provided with a second recess 212 for accommodating the heat insulation box 400. In this embodiment, the sidewall of the first recess 113 can restrict the sliding of the battery cell 300 on the first carrier plate 11, and the first fixing component restricts the battery cell 300 within the first recess 113. The sidewall of the second recess 212 can restrict the sliding of the heat insulation box 400 on the second carrier plate 21, and the second fixing component restricts the heat insulation box 400 within the second recess 212.

[0048] One end of the thermocouple 500 is connected to a measuring instrument in the insulation box 400, and the other end of the thermocouple 500 is directly placed on the solar cell 300 to measure the temperature of the solar cell 300. When the conveyor belt 100 or the ceramic roller 200 vibrates, it can easily cause the thermocouple 500 to shake, resulting in the other end of the thermocouple 500 shaking relative to the solar cell 300, causing inaccurate temperature measurements. Optionally, the solar cell temperature measuring device also includes a limiting ring 13, which is used to fix the thermocouple 500 to the first carrier plate 11. In this embodiment, this setting, which fixes the thermocouple 500 to the first carrier plate 11, can improve the accuracy of temperature measurement.

[0049] Optionally, the limiting ring 13 is a U-shaped ring, and the first carrier plate 11 is provided with two insertion holes. The two free ends of the limiting ring 13 are inserted into the two insertion holes, and the thermocouple 500 is located in the U-shaped groove of the limiting ring 13, thereby pressing the thermocouple 500 onto the first carrier plate 11.

[0050] Optionally, the two free ends of the limiting ring 13 are tapered, and the two insertion holes on the first carrier plate 11 are tapered, with the two free ends of the limiting ring 13 and the two insertion holes being interference-fitted.

[0051] Optionally, the first carrier plate 11 includes a first plate body 114 and a heat insulation layer 115, with the heat insulation layer 115 laid on the first plate body 114 and the battery cell 300 located on the heat insulation layer 115. In this embodiment, the heat insulation layer 115 can insulate the heat of the first plate body 114, thereby preventing the heat on the first plate body 114 from being transferred to the battery cell 300, and improving the accuracy of temperature measurement of the battery cell 300.

[0052] Optionally, the area of ​​the first carrier plate 11 opposite to the battery cell 300 is provided with a hollow portion. In this embodiment, the hollow portion can reduce the contact area between the first carrier plate 11 and the battery cell 300, thereby reducing the heat transferred from the first carrier plate 11 to the battery cell 300 and improving the accuracy of temperature measurement of the battery cell 300. Specifically, the hollow portion is a rectangular hole, and multiple hollow portions are provided at intervals.

[0053] Optionally, the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 are integrally molded parts. In this embodiment, this arrangement can improve the connection strength between the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 and reduce production costs. In other embodiments, the first carrier plate 11 and the second carrier plate 21 are detachably connected.
